Overview of Lesotho Football Team
The Lesotho national football team represents the Kingdom of Lesotho, a landlocked country in Southern Africa. The team competes in the COSAFA Cup and participates in African Cup of Nations qualifiers. They play their home matches at Setsoto Stadium in Maseru.
Team History and Achievements
Lesotho’s football history is marked by participation in regional competitions like the COSAFA Cup. Although they have not yet qualified for the FIFA World Cup or African Cup of Nations, they have shown promise with performances in qualifiers and friendly matches.
